    Report on clean-up of South Cemetery 1938
    Report on clean-up of South Cemetery 1938
    "Blandinsville's South Cemetery which last week at this time was a wilderness of weeds and brambles, is this week clean and trim. The transformation was brought about last Suturday when 40 men answered the call of Trustees Evan Williams, B. B. Martin and Blake Jones, Equipped with scythes, grubbing hoes, pitch forks and sickles, all 40 of them lit in on the mass of tangled overgrowth and laid it low. It was a big job. The cemetery was grown high not only with weeds but with tall grass that a scythe would scarcely cut. It required a lot of patient hacking, as well as a lot of hard labor. But it was all cut down, and trucks were kept busy all the afternoon in hauling away the the trash and hay. The amount of it was almost unbelievable."
